直接**展示:
/**
* 找出陣列中的不重複值
* @param array $arr 一維陣列
* @param boolean $falg 是否嚴格驗證
* @return array 返回不重複的值
*/function find_arr_unrepeat($arr,$falg = false)
} }return $data;
}/**
* 找出特定值在陣列中的出現次數
* @param string|int $key 查詢的值
* @param array $arr 所有值
* @param boolean $falg 是否嚴格驗證
* @return int
*/function in_array_num($key,$arr,$falg = false)
} return $i;
}$arr = [3,'3',4,5,6,4,2,2,1];
echo '
普通:';
var_export(find_arr_unrepeat($arr));
echo '
嚴格:';
var_export(find_arr_unrepeat($arr,true));
普通:array ( 0 => 5, 1 => 6, 2 => 1, )
嚴格:array ( 0 => 3, 1 => '3', 2 => 5, 3 => 6, 4 => 1, )
$arr = [3,'3',4,5,6,4,2,2,1];
function find_arr_unrepeats($arr)
} return $data;
}print_r(find_arr_unrepeats($arr));
結果輸出:
array ( [0] => 5 [1] => 6 [2] => 1 )
找出陣列中不重複的數 Java
這個問題是我在乙個面經裡面看到的,沒有問題的具體描述,所以我做了如下設想 1.陣列是整數陣列 1 不重複的數字只有乙個,那麼問題就很簡單了,就退化成劍指offer上面的乙個原題了,解決辦法就是遍歷陣列,異或每乙個數,最後剩下的就是那個唯一不重複的數,如下 public static int numb...
PHP 判斷陣列中是否有重複值並找出重複值
可以用來測試需要唯一憑據號碼的,是否有重複值,不過一般直接使用uuid了,簡單粗暴就解決問題,這個就簡單的測試生成的資料是否有重複值吧 author wyy date 2019 01 09 13 34 16 email 2752154874 qq.com last modified by wyy l...
如何在大量的資料中找出不重複的整數?
在 2.5 億個整數中找出不重複的整數。注意 記憶體不足以容納這 2.5 億個整數。方法一 分治法 與前面的題目方法類似,先將 2.5 億個數劃分到多個小檔案,用 hashset hashmap 找出每個小檔案中不重複的整數,再合併每個子結果,即為最終結果。方法二 位圖法 位圖,就是用乙個或多個 b...